dhitchco 09-01-2006 15:42

Re: Poof Ball?
 
I just got off the phone with official Poof-Slinky factory in Michigan

1) Orders MUST be in case-quantities of 12
2) Unit price is US$4.00 plus shipping (they do take credit cards)
3) FedEx seems to be their preferred US shipper; don't know about outside U.S.
4) They are "scrambling" to produce more inventory as US FIRST didn't give them advance warning that over 1,000 high schools would be descending on them to order this week.
5) Smaller orders can be done via their web site

Too bad I didn't buy their stock last week!

Mike Betts 09-01-2006 17:51

Re: Poof Ball?
 
The following FIRST Email Blast is now going out to all teams:

Quote:

Greetings Teams:

Poof-Slinky has offered the following option for teams:

For a minimum order of 48 balls, teams can call customer service (800) 329-8697 with a credit card and order the #850 Basketball at the wholesale price of $4 each plus FedEx Ground shipping.

**Important** - in order to get the discounted price, you cannot place the order on-line; you must call the number above.

Go Teams!
